## Description of change
Add two options:

1. option to adjust poll rate
2. option to change emulation size

Also, the default configuration is changing from:

* ~1000Hz ish to 120Hz (default)
* 3x3 point to 1x1 point

In theory this does not make a meaningful change to how the game plays.
But if people want the old behavior they can change it.

## Testing
Tested on Volzza2 and Reflesia.
